-The image I have is second-year tight end Weslye Saunders stalking around the entrance of the South Side facility like a caged animal. He's more than ready to break his league-imposed vow of silence with the team, and re-join his team in the short week of work before taking on the Titans in Week 6 Thursday.

Roughly around the same time the building opens, they are likely to announce the release of a player to make room for Saunders on their active roster.

The decision seems far less dramatic than that, however. The fact rookie David Paulson, and not Leonard Pope, served as the team's No. 2 tight end in a 16-14 victory over Philadelphia in Week 5 speaks for the situation.

Pope's release four games into the 2012 season seems imminent, making Paulson - the fourth 7th round draft pick to make the Steelers active roster since 2009 - a permanent member of the team.

And he did it with grit. Cutting his teeth on special teams, Paulson got his first career catch in Week 5, an eight-yard completion on 1st-and-20, the first positive play on the Steelers' nine-play, 51 yard drive that resulted in Shaun Suisham's game-winning field goal.

Steelers release TE Saunders

The Steelers released tight end Weslye Saunders today after he served his four-game NFL suspension for taking a banned substance -- a move that points up the development of rookie David Paulson and the team's interest in him.
The Steelers had until 4 p.m. today to decide if they wanted to keep Saunders or release Paulson or veteran backup Leonard Pope.
Pope, who was signed in free agency from the Kansas City Chiefs, where he played for offensive coordinator Todd Haley, has not played the past two games.
But, because he is a vested veteran, Pope would have to be paid the minimum of $840,000 even if he were released.
Paulson, a sixth round pick, has played extensively the past two games and was lauded by Coach Mike Tomlin last week as a player "who the game is not too big for."
